Lebanon – The lure of Puglia

The Italian region of Puglia was recently presented as a tourist destination in Lebanon in a promotional event organised by Pugliapromozione and the Italian embassy in Beirut, with the participation of ambassador Giuseppe Morabito and Lebanese Minister for Industry Vrej Sabounjian.

USA – Week of events in Washington to celebrate Verdi

A full week of events to celebrate the bicentennial of Giuseppe Verdi: Essential Verdi Week will feature a series of performances by the 200-voice Washington Chorus, as they join forces with Italian embassy in the U.S. to pay homage to the great Italian composer. Read more, in Italian

Vancouver – 49 Italian UNESCO sites showcased

Vancouver’s Pendulum Gallery and Italian Cultural Institute are jointly hosting an exhibition through March 1st of photographs of the 49 UNESCO World Heritage Sites located in Italy, which boasts the largest number in the world, followed by Spain and France. Read more, in Italian

Montreal – ‘Cinema e Cibo’, an Italian marathon

The Italy House, Italian Cultural Institute and Societe de developpement commercial Petite-Italie Marche Jean-Talon of Montreal have organised “Cinema e Cibo” for Saturday March 1st: an all-night marathon of film screenings and gastronomic delights to showcase masterpieces of Italian creativity in both sectors.
